Official Profile

Age Unknown (appears to be in late teens)
Height 136 cm
Race Draph
Hobbies Taking walks, sleeping, eating, playing with animals
Likes Moving her body, cake, sweets, eating
Dislikes Using her head, distrusting people

Trivia

  • Threo's name in Japanese is "Saraasa" or "thalaatha/ثلاثة", which is Arabic for "three".
  • Threo, along with Ghandagoza, is the only known Draph who's horns change color upon reaching 5★.
  • Threo is the only member of The Eternals to have a Specialty with two different weapons.
